Conventionally, roofs with tile sticks have been widely constructed using groove boards (roof boards), hangers, and the like. This tile stick roof becomes obsolete due to long-term use,
Or if it became corroded and rainwater entered the room, it became necessary to replace it with a new roof, and the tile-stick roof was completely removed and replaced with a new roof. During this removal, companies, factories, etc. may collect dust, etc. during removal, remove various parts such as groove plates may fall, and in case of rain, tents may be used to protect equipment and products. , tents, etc. had to be set up, and the work or operations of companies, factories, etc. had to be temporarily suspended, and the losses and damages inflicted on companies and factories were enormous. In addition, in gymnasiums, if the floor gets wet with rain, many slip accidents occur during competitions, or the floor warps, making it impossible to hold official competitions, so it is essential to install tents, etc. It was hot.
In addition, in general houses, if roof replacement work is carried out while residents are still living, there is a possibility that it will get rained on, and the removed areas must be replaced with a new roof within the same day, making it difficult to maintain consistency in the work. The disadvantage was that it was troublesome and had poor work efficiency. In either case, it takes time and effort to remove the existing tile-stick roof, which not only halts the functions of businesses and residences, but also increases the number of construction days required to replace the new roof. There were drawbacks such as high costs. In addition, in conventional roof replacement, as a fixing means, a hanger is fixed from above to the main building of the existing tile and stick roof using bolts, nuts, drill screws, etc. When trying to do this on site, the main building cannot be seen from above the roof, so the position is measured in advance using a scale, etc., but even with this, it is often not always possible to securely attach the main building from above. It was. In reality, it was extremely difficult to securely attach the hangers to the main building on the existing tile-stick roof, which was not visible to the naked eye. From such a thing,
There was a drawback that the adhesion force of the hanger was reduced, and the newly installed roof that was attached to it could fly off quickly.

Therefore, as a result of intensive research in order to eliminate the above-mentioned drawbacks, the inventor has developed the present invention by attaching a hook extending downward from both sides of the gate-shaped part of the hanger main body to the appropriate position of the tile bar part of the existing tile bar roof. A movable hanger for repair is provided with movable tongue pieces that slide appropriately on the top surface of the gate-shaped part, and the claws bite into both sides of the tile bar part and fix it,
A main plate of a seam weldable architectural board, which has sloped parts on both sides of the main plate, a top part formed outward from the upper ends of both sloped parts, and a rising part from the outer end, is placed on the existing tile-stick roof. The top part was placed on the top surface of the hanger main body while the movable tongue piece of the movable hanger for repair was sandwiched between the opposing rising parts of the adjacent construction board, and these were seam-welded. This eliminates the need for removing the existing tile stick roof, and allows a new roof to be easily and quickly constructed using seam welding, creating an extremely watertight and airtight roof. We can provide
Furthermore, the entire roof can be strengthened, and in particular, the movable hanger for repair can be attached reliably and firmly, thus solving the above-mentioned problems.

In addition, since a new roof is constructed by seam welding on top of the existing tile stick roof A, the seam welded joints are completely watertight (rainproof), especially when the new roof is installed after construction. Even if an ice embankment forms and standing water occurs, it will not infiltrate the interior at all, and water leakage can be reliably prevented. Furthermore, since it is joined by beam welding, it has excellent airtightness and good soundproofing performance.
Insulation can also be improved by combining it with the existing tile stick roof A.

Furthermore, when constructing a new roof by seam welding, the tile rod portion A1 of the existing tile rod roof A can be used as a guide for allocation, making the construction even easier. In addition, even if the new seam-welded roof expands and contracts due to the outside temperature, the movable hanger B for repairing the new roof
The movable tongue piece 6 can slide appropriately to absorb the thermal expansion and contraction, and the new roof created by seam welding can be completely free from thermal stress distortion.
In addition, the existing tile stick roof A and the new roof will be double-roofed, making the whole structure strong against external forces (tensile loads such as snow load and wind pressure).
It goes without saying that it can also be used as a reinforcing wall for an existing tiled roof wall that is appropriately inclined.
